We are always on the lookout for small, non-luxury hotels directly on the beach. This hotel ticked all the boxes. It is a lovely location, with a wonderful pool, and very warm and friendly staff who are helpful and thoughtful. For these reasons, we enjoyed our stay. However, one very large factor will stop us from returning, sadly. That's the cost of food and beverage. But especially the food. The prices are comparable to a restaurant (not coffee shop) in Singapore, or perhaps a luxury resort. Apart from fried rice or fried noodles, the portions are average. Disappointing was the SGD$22 (incl. taxes) sup buntut. While a soup itself was delicious, the two bones with no meat on them was really unacceptable for the price. The ikan bakar was SGD$20 (incl. taxes) and it was the size of two hands. This turned a potentially reasonably priced long weekend away into an unexpectedly expensive few days. There are no other eating options in the general area. We do understand that operating from a relatively remote area drives up costs, but we honestly feel that a reasonable driven up price would be 50% of what is currently charged for food. Having been in a rush on the day we left, we didn't have time to chat about this with the friendly owner, but we hope he takes this feedback in stride.
